Rosewood is a small town located in Pennsylvania. It is also the main setting for all seven seasons of Pretty Little Liars. It is the hometown of the Liars in the series. Rosewood may be a small town, but it has its own daily newspaper associated with it: The Rosewood Observer.

Though Rosewood isn't real, local fans know "Pretty Little Liars" isn't shy about name-dropping real nearby towns and landmarks. Mega-hit teen series "Pretty Little Liars" is one of the most Tweeted about shows on television. But before it had millions of social media-savvy viewers tuning in each week, it was a book series written by local author Sara Shepard. The bestsellers are based loosely on Shepard's experience growing up on the Main Line; it's all set in the town of "Rosewood," a fictionalized version of Rosemont, Montgomery County. The show may be filmed in Los Angeles, but the Liars frequently find themselves in the soundstage versions of parks, neighborhoods and museums from the Philly area.

Rosewood is a glamorous and picturesque town located in eastern area of Pennsylvania. It is also the main setting for all books in Pretty Little Liars. Contrary to the famous adaptation. Rosewood is an idyllic, wealthy, and incredibly prestigious town twenty miles from Philadelphia. It is so big that it has its own luxury shopping center called King James and a private school called Rosewood Day. Rosewood was founded by William W. The majority of the residents are in the upper class and many families, such as the Hastings, have had significant wealth dating back to the s. Rosewood is essentially a "country-glam" suburb. It has everything from farms, picturesque cornfields, and pastures to barns converted into apartments and other types of buildings. In fact, many of the mansions were converted from large farms. Many homes are close to woodsy areas. Emily's backyard is bordered by the woods, Spencer and Alison's neighborhood is essentially surrounded by a small forest, and the Kahns ' vast property is also bordered by a forest.
